Introduce nvm executable

nvm.sh isn't executable so this file was introduced. It dereferences symlinks for e.g `ln -s ~/.nvm/nvm ~/bin/nvm` will now work.

#!/bin/bash
# Get this script after dereferincing all symlinks
# !! Doesn't check for circular symlinks !!
SOURCE="${BASH_SOURCE[0]}"
while [ -h "$SOURCE" ]; do # resolve $SOURCE until the file is no longer a symlink
DIR="$( cd -P "$( dirname "$SOURCE" )" && pwd )"
SOURCE="$(readlink "$SOURCE")"
[[ $SOURCE != /* ]] && SOURCE="$DIR/$SOURCE" # if $SOURCE was a relative symlink, we need to resolve it relative to the path where the symlink file was located
done
DIR="$( cd -P "$( dirname "$SOURCE" )" && pwd )"
source "$DIR/nvm.sh"
'nvm' $@
